

Musician Kid Koala has released a limited edition CD and LP set of his new album 12 Bit Blues. Included is a working cardboard turntable that the buyer gets to assemble her/himself. A Flexidisc is provided to give the device something to play, and a cardboard cone amplifies the sound as the user spins the record by hand.
With the music industry going through a very obvious sea change in the last several years, it’s great to see artists getting creative when it comes to their new releases. Kid Koala venturing into the DIY spectrum is particularly refreshing.
